What is an entry level remote environmental job?

Entry level remote environmental jobs are positions in the environmental field that do not require extensive prior experience and can be performed from home or another remote location. These roles often involve tasks such as data entry, research support, report writing, environmental monitoring, or assisting with sustainability initiatives. Common employers include environmental consulting firms, nonprofit organizations, and government agencies. These jobs typically require at least a bachelor’s degree in environmental science or a related field, though some may accept candidates with relevant skills or certifications. Remote positions offer flexibility and the chance to contribute to environmental protection from any location.

What do entry level remote environmental professionals do?

Entry-level remote environmental professionals often support projects such as data analysis, report preparation, environmental monitoring, and research on regulations or site conditions. They may assist in compiling environmental impact assessments, updating databases, or preparing presentations for internal and external stakeholders. Collaboration is typically conducted through virtual meetings, project management platforms, and shared digital documents to ensure seamless communication with team members such as senior scientists, project managers, and clients. This structure allows for continuous learning and mentorship, even in a remote setting.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an entry level remote environmental specialist?

To thrive as an Entry Level Remote Environmental Specialist, you generally need a bachelor's degree in environmental science or a related field, along with basic data analysis and research skills. Familiarity with GIS software, Microsoft Office Suite, and environmental monitoring tools or databases is often required. Strong written communication, attention to detail, and self-motivation are important soft skills for remote collaboration and independent work. These competencies ensure accurate data collection, effective reporting, and successful teamwork in a virtual environmental work setting.

What is the difference between Entry Level Remote Environmental vs Entry Level Remote Sustainability Coordinator?

AspectEntry Level Remote EnvironmentalEntry Level Remote Sustainability Coordinator
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Environmental Science or related fieldBachelor's in Environmental Studies, Sustainability, or related field
Work EnvironmentRemote, often collaborative with environmental agencies or NGOsRemote, working with corporate or nonprofit sustainability teams
Industry UsageEnvironmental protection, conservation, researchSustainable business practices, corporate social responsibility
Common Search IntentEntry level environmental roles, remote environmental jobsEntry level sustainability roles, remote sustainability jobs

While both roles focus on environmental and sustainability issues, Entry Level Remote Environmental typically emphasizes environmental protection and research, whereas Entry Level Remote Sustainability Coordinator centers on implementing sustainable practices within organizations. Both require similar educational backgrounds and are often found in remote work settings, but they serve different industry needs and career paths.

Are remote environmental jobs in demand?

Remote environmental jobs, including roles such as environmental analysts and sustainability coordinators, are increasingly in demand due to growing focus on climate change and corporate sustainability initiatives. These positions often require skills in data analysis, environmental regulations, and remote collaboration tools, reflecting a broader trend toward flexible work arrangements in the environmental sector.

What are entry-level remote environmental positions?

Entry-level remote environmental positions include roles such as environmental technician, sustainability coordinator, or data analyst, often requiring basic knowledge of environmental science, data management, or environmental regulations. These positions typically involve tasks like data collection, research, reporting, and using tools such as GIS software or environmental monitoring equipment, with some roles requiring relevant certifications or a degree in environmental science or related fields.
